How to conjugate reprimir in Indicative Present in Spanish

reprimir
to repress, to suppress
regular verb

Reprimir means to suppress or restrain feelings, actions, or impulses. It is often used in contexts related to controlling emotions, desires, or behaviors.

How to conjugate reprimir in Indicative Present

El Presente - used to talk about situations, events or thoughts that are happening now or in the near future

Indicative Present Conjugations

PronounConjugation
Yo
reprimo
reprimes
Él / Ella / Usted
reprime
Nosotros / Nosotras
reprimimos
Vosotros / Vosotras
reprimís
Ellos / Ellas / Ustedes
reprimen

Examples of reprimir in Indicative Present

Yo
Yo reprimo mis sentimientos a veces.
I sometimes repress my feelings.
Tú reprimes tus emociones muy bien.
You repress your emotions very well.
Él / Ella / Usted
Ella reprime sus deseos en público.
She represses her desires in public.
Nosotros / Nosotras
Nosotros reprimimos las críticas negativas.
We repress negative criticisms.
Vosotros / Vosotras
Vosotros reprimís las ganas de llorar.
You all repress the urge to cry.
Ellos / Ellas / Ustedes
Ellos reprimen sus impulsos constantemente.
They constantly repress their impulses.
